The Ultimate Guide to Choosing Quality Hazelnuts
Hazelnuts are a tasty treat. They are also good for you. You can eat them raw, roasted, or in your favorite recipes. But not all hazelnuts are the same. This guide helps you pick the best ones.
Key Features to Look For
When you buy hazelnuts, check these things:
- Freshness: Good hazelnuts smell nutty. They don’t smell musty or stale.
- Shell Condition: If you buy them in the shell, look for shells that are smooth and unbroken. No cracks or holes.
- Nut Size: Bigger nuts usually mean a richer flavor.
- Color: Whole, shelled hazelnuts should have a light brown skin.

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ality
Many things can make your hazelnuts better or worse.
Factors That Improve Quality:
- Harvesting Time: Hazelnuts harvested at the right time are sweeter and have a better texture.
- Storage: Hazelnuts stay fresh longer when stored in a cool, dry place. An airtight container is best.
- Roasting: Proper roasting brings out the nutty flavor. It also makes them easier to digest. Small batches are often roasted with more care.
- Origin: Some regions are known for growing excellent hazelnuts. Turkey and Italy are famous for their quality.
Factors That Reduce Quality:
- Old Stock: Hazelnuts that have been stored for a long time can become rancid. This means they taste bad.
- Poor Storage: Heat and moisture make hazelnuts go bad quickly.
- Pests: Insects can damage hazelnuts. Look for signs of this.
- Over-roasting: This can make hazelnuts bitter.

Frequently Asked Questions About Quality Hazelnuts
Q: What is the best way to store hazelnuts?
A: Store hazelnuts in an airtight container in a cool, dry place. The refrigerator is a good option for longer storage.
Q: Should I buy hazelnuts in the shell or shelled?
A: Hazelnuts in the shell stay fresh longer. Shelled hazelnuts are more convenient for immediate use.
Q: How can I tell if hazelnuts are fresh?
A: Fresh hazelnuts have a pleasant, nutty smell. They should not smell musty or bitter.
Q: Are roasted hazelnuts healthy?
A: Roasted hazelnuts can be healthy, especially if roasted with healthy oils and little salt. Roasting can make them easier to digest.
Q: What does “rancid” mean for hazelnuts?
A: Rancid hazelnuts have gone bad. They taste unpleasant, often bitter or like old oil.
Q: Can I freeze hazelnuts?
A: Yes, you can freeze hazelnuts. Put them in an airtight container or freezer bag. This keeps them fresh for many months.
Q: What are the health benefits of hazelnuts?
A: Hazelnuts are a good source of healthy fats, fiber, vitamins, and minerals. They can be good for your heart.
Q: Where do the best quality hazelnuts come from?
A: Turkey and Italy are well-known for producing high-quality hazelnuts with rich flavors.
Q: How do I roast hazelnuts myself?
A: Spread shelled hazelnuts on a baking sheet. Roast at 350°F (175°C) for 10-15 minutes, stirring halfway. Watch them closely so they don’t burn.
Q: What is the difference between hazelnut flour and ground hazelnuts?
A: Hazelnut flour is finely ground hazelnuts. Ground hazelnuts can be coarser. Both are great for baking.
